Lose focus angular js download

Sep 11, 2019 good morning hristo, thanks for the answer but its not what im looking for. The mdchips, an angular directive, is used as a special component called chip and can be used to represent a small set of information for example, a contact, tags etc. I was hoping that angularjs would have some directive for the same. Angularjs set focus on input field form value example. An attribute directive that will trigger focus on an element under specified conditions. Changes may occur through an api but as long as they originate from the user, the provided source should still be user. Angularjs ngfocusout directive if you are new in angularjs you can use this by adding in your html tag. Jsfi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. Execute an expresson when the input field loses focus onblur loses focus when ngmodel references ngrepeat array. If an element is removed from dom, then it also causes the focus loss. Setting focus in angular 2 requires working with native dom elements. If you observe above angularjs example we are changing textbox colour whenever textbox gets or lost focus using ngfocus and ngblur event in application. The issue was that input field was auto focussed only the first time i opened the modal.

The value of the attribute is the order number of the element when tab or something like that is used to switch between them. Good morning hristo, thanks for the answer but its not what im looking for. To accomplish this, i could simply have bound to the window blur and focus events within the title directive link function and called it a day. Bug tracker roadmap vote for features about docs service status. Angular 8 simply is the latest version of the angular framework and simply an update to angular 2. Angular the complete guide 2020 edition udemy free download.

Since in this example, there should happen no dom reordering, this needs an investigation. Closed djmarcus1 opened this issue nov 18, 2015 10 comments. This is distinct from the blur event in that it supports detecting the loss of focus on descendant elements in other words, it supports event bubbling. I have explained the same using angular 25 concept as well, for that please check this link. A custom template can be used to render the content of a chip. Angular 9 simply is the latest version of the angular framework and simply an update to angular 2. The powerful features and capabilities of angular allow you to create complex, customizable, modern, responsive and user friendly web applications.

I came across the problem of setting the focus on input field when the field was shown conditionally by ngshow directive of angularjs. If it is reinserted later, then the focus doesnt return. I will teach you a very simple directive which will hopefully suffice all your. Change form label color when in focus material design for. As the blur event is executed synchronously also during dom manipulations e. Bind an event handler to the focusout javascript event. You want to focus an input control and the builtin autofocus attribute does not work the way you want. Ngfocus examples, ngfocus angular example, ngfocus use in angular, best examples of ngfocus, angular examples. For example, when a user clicks on the toolbar, technically the toolbar module calls a quill api to effect the change. In the first part of this series about supporting focus and blur events i elected to follow the template in the angularjs source code for event directives. Change form label color when in focus material design. Grab the latest from github or use your favorite package manager via bower bower install angularautofocus via npm npm install angularautofocus usage. There is the ofcourse the jquery way to do it on document ready, however.

This example displays the text message enter your text here when the input is focused and hide it when the input focus loses. Trying to figure out if the blink or the jump is worse. Download the release or minified install via bower. Declarative templates with databinding, mvc, dependency injection and great testability story all implemented with pure clientside javascript.

What i intend is that when i use the tab key to move from one button to another and the button receives the focus i change the background color whenever this toggle is off. Angularjs ngfocus and ngblur directives one way to get them. Adding autofocus to an input field in an angular 5 bootstrap. Angular 2 about us contact us ngfocus what is ngfocus. Focus text demo this page demonstrates the use of a focus text control built in angular js. I just had to add this to style the message body box as it uses the textarea tag instead of input. Angular js directive to disable mouse wheel on input type. But source is still user since the origin of the change was the users click.

Angularjs ngblur event function with example tutlane. All code belongs to the poster and no license is enforced. Angular material chips the mdchips, an angular directive, is used as a special component called chip and can be used to represent a small set of information for example, a contact, t. Angularjs is what html would have been, had it been designed for building webapps. Angular js auto focus for input box create a directive for autofocus and use where ever you need on the module. The ngblur directive from angularjs will not override the elements original onblur event, both the ngblur expression and the original onblur event will be executed. Really sad there isnt something built into the html for this since it can get really annoying. An angular attribute directive that gives focus on an element depending on a given expression. Angular 8 formerly angular 2 the complete guide udemy. The focus text input itself is an angular js directive, and im using less css for some of the more complicated css rules.

So it looks like we have a choice between two apis, elementref and renderer. Angular js directive to disable mouse wheel on input type number ignoremousewheel. The ng focus directive tells angularjs what to do when an html element gets focus. Adding autofocus to an input field in an angular 5. An alert moves focus to itself, so it causes the focus loss at the element blur event, and when the alert is dismissed, the focus comes back focus event. Mar 28, 2016 angularjs set focus on input field there are many ways to set focus on input field using angularjs. In this article, julio sampaio demonstrates how to create an application built on top of angular with an asp. These features sometimes cause focusblur handlers to. Angularjs ngfocusout directive if you are new in angularjs. Or you have tried and tested a bunch of solutions from stackoverflow, and although some of them are really good, they do not suffice your needs worry not. Angular is faster than angular 1 and offers a much more flexible and modular development approach. I was trying to search for a way in which i can put the focus on a single form input element inside the html form. It can also be used as a crossbrowser replacement for the autofocus attribute. In angularjs ngblur event is used to call function or raise validation when input text control lost its focus.

Angularjs ngfocus and ngblur directives one way to get them before they get released. You need to create a directive first so that the code work well. There are some ways to line focus on input field using angularjs. This means you can just drop in the new version, remove the custom. A simple angular directive to set focus to an element raw. The problem i was facing was to close a layer typically a small popup when clicking outside of the directives markup. Oct, 2015 to accomplish this, i could simply have bound to the window blur and focus events within the title directive link function and called it a day. This can be achieved by specifying an mdchiptemplate element having the custom content as a child of mdchips. Apr 16, 2014 angular js auto focus for input box create a directive for autofocus and use where ever you need on the module. It would help if there was some documentation on angular gotcha.

But, again, as an exercise and to create a more flexible solution, i wanted to create a more generalized usecase. Install with npm view source on github doc humanizedoc directivebrackets. Angular 2 about us contact us ng focus what is ng focus. How to create autofocus directive certain elements angular 4. In the example above, when a user clicks on the input field the dosomething method will be invoked. Angularjs set focus on input field there are many ways to set focus on input field using angularjs. This proved to be quite insightful as the angularjs team just released 1.

Here in this tutorial we are going to explain how you can set focus on input field using the angularjs. The ngblur directive tells angularjs what to do when an html element loses focus. This short tutorial i will share how to build and use autofocus directive in angular 4. Ie window loses focus on start of angular app with. The project is built using angular 5 and bootstrap 4. Ng focus examples, ng focus angular example, ng focus use in angular, best examples of ng focus, angular examples. A protip by belaezsias about javascript and angularjs.

Angular js directive to disable mouse wheel on input. Angular the complete guide 2020 edition udemy download. A simple angular directive to set focus to an element github. Angularjs ngfocus and ngblur directives one way to get. It replaces an input of type text and provides some fancy animations and highlight options for when the user focuses on it. While this is possible, the documentation recommends against doing so. Focus on an input element by default on angular form load. How to detect blur and focus element on the entire div. Add row with everpresentrow when lose focus angular, vue. Sep 07, 2016 jquery ui widgets forums grid add row with everpresentrow when lose focus tagged. A couple of days back i faced trouble adding autofocus to an input field that was rendered inside a bootstrap modal. Declarative templates with databinding, mvw, mvvm, mvc, dependency injection and great testability story all implemented with pure clientside javascript. Angularjs set focus on input field with example onlinecode. Set focus to elements angular2focus angular script.

I could not find a built in directive for the focusout event, so here it is. Before using, consider renaming ngfocus and ngblur to something that doesnt invade the ng namespace, e. A simple angular directive to set focus to an element angular setfocus directive. Adding autofocus to an input field in an angular 5 bootstrap 4 application a couple of days back i faced trouble adding autofocus to an input field that was rendered inside a bootstrap modal. Apr 25, 2019 building an angular application with asp. The html autofocus attribute doesnt consistently work across different browsers when an element is inserted into the dom after the initial page load. In angular, using autofocus attribute unlike html5 javascript code in general.

855 422 1450 486 1565 720 993 229 138 522 612 920 1513 296 1131 750 112 56 270 1245 961 1072 381 513 1086 8 1395 744 1371 770 1231 275 1070 1180 828